the thing is so here's i don't know if this is agreeing with you or disagreeing with you but there was some real poetry in last night because the player he's always reminded me of and the player that i have always felt before he tries to chase down lebron and jordan the guy the first guy he wants to check off the list is akeem olajuwon the best international player ever is akeem wemby's coming for that the best defensive player since bill russell is akeem wemby's coming for that and then once he passes akeem then you then he you know tries to move up the list to become one of if not the greatest player ever and akeem was while he didn't shoot threes because back then you know only a handful of players shot threes he was the best mid range shooting big man ever he was the best defender in the league while being able to give you thirty a night wimby has taken all of that added seven inches of height and twelve feet of range and has been a different player but the reason last night was special was because we talked about a day in may in two thousand seven well may twenty fifth nineteen ninety five akeem olajuwon sat across the court from david stern as david stern handed david robinson an mvp trophy that akeem was damn sure belonged to him and hakeem said to kenny smith and anyone that would listen i'm going to show the world who the mvp is tonight and thirty one years later nearly to the day wemby did the same thing akeem that night had forty one points sixteen rebounds four assists two steals three blocks wemby last night had forty one points twenty four rebounds three assists one steal three blocks thirty years thirty one years almost the day later two guys international unprecedented big men saw someone else win an award that they actually didn't really deserve but they thought they did and then they went and embarrassed that guy on their home court it's pretty special it is
